I have been quoted fairly reasonable rates for a week-long stay at both
hotels. If staying in a suite, on an upper floor, with a full harbour view,
which hotel would be the best? I've read most of the reviews. I have
never stayed at the Bishop Lei, which is reasonably ranked for value. I
went for the suite, since HK hotel rooms are notoriously small and too
confining for a stay of nine days, even if the room is basically used for
sleeping. Both locations have their merits. Thanks in advance.


Given the choice, I would definitely stay at the YMCA because of its
better location. The Bishop Lei is a reasonable hotel, but being up in
mid-levels requires that bit of extra time and effort getting to and
from the hotel.
